Analysis and Conclusion:
Section 29 of the Special Marriage Act, 1954, primarily serves as a procedural safeguard, requiring courts’ leave before filing divorce petitions within one year of marriage. This provision aims to prevent impulsive divorces and ensure that marriages are given a reasonable period before dissolution proceedings commence. Courts have consistently held that this leave is mandatory, and non-compliance leads to dismissal of the petition. The section's application is broad, affecting divorce, annulment, and related matrimonial proceedings, and must be adhered to strictly for the maintainability of such cases.
